logo

Output 86df3274542fefbbd516f894a063a70596bd019a3fa1b5692f634c406d402177:1

value
26895692
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2b95263e1f3ca20b61674a22dc3906bff4f977e1 OP_EQUALVERIFY OP_CHECKSIG
address
14ySjL848iod7EDymYr1k6qodrQBSPHhWr
transaction
86df3274542fefbbd516f894a063a70596bd019a3fa1b5692f634c406d402177